Effluvium

(ĭ-flo͞oˈvē-əm)
noun pl. effluvia ef·flu·vi·a (-vē-ə) or ef·flu·vi·ums
A usually invisible emanation or exhalation, as of vapor or gas.
a. A byproduct or residue; waste.
b. The odorous fumes given off by waste or decaying matter.
An impalpable emanation; an aura.
